超级狗 (@super_dog) 在 用AI搞了个定时备份mysql数据库并通知的脚本 中发帖
因为有数据库在云平台,担心哪天数据丢失,所以让ai搞了个备份脚本。功能简单没难度,仅根据我自己备份场景实现。
功能:
1、定时备份,并保留最新的几个备份文件,每次备份后,根据设置的文件大小下限,低于下限进行报警通知
2、每天下午18点会发送当前备份结果。 因为我是每两小时备份一些,所以下午18点会执行一次,可以根据自己的情况调整定时通知时间
前置条件:
本地提前安装好 mysqldump
修改的地方:
1、执行用户下增加数据库文件:vim ~/.my.cnf
# xxxa 的 mysql
[client_server_a]
host=xxxa
user=xxxa
password=xxxa
port=3306
# xxxb 的 mysql
[client_server_b]
host=xxxb
user=xxxb
password=xxxb
port=3306
2、备...